390  Economy / Gambling discussion / Re: Why sports betting? on: December 02, 2023, 04:44:13 PM
I prefer sports betting because it's the only type of gambling which is always truly provably fair. You can't fake sports results, you can always check the results on any sports website. Additionally, some experience and in-depth knowledge of the sport you're betting on as well as some insider info may help you. Such things are useless if you're playing casino games for example.
That's true, but there have been incidents with fixed matches in soccer. I'm not sure how valid this information is, but it's something that is quite commonly mentioned, especially in soccer. I'm not really into sports; I've made a few bets in the past, but nothing fancy, although, to my surprise, most casinos now offer a wide variety of sports, from soccer to badminton, wrestling, and so on, and even cover e-sports such as CS:GO and League of Legends. However, I agree that sport betting is a combination of luck, skill, strategy, and knowledge, deriving from the old-fashioned gambling games that rely only on luck.

Fixed matches are happening in sports, and every smart sports bettors know about this. Since it's commonplace, bettors don't complain anymore when a game is fixed, as sportsbooks would still pay if their bet wins. Therefore, choosing the right side is crucial for winning. This phenomenon occurs not only in soccer but also in various other sports, although not all instances of game fixing have been exposed. As a gambler, you should always consider this reality as a vital factor when analyzing a particular game.

Have you ever noticed when a team that is heavily favored, with spreads that could easily be covered, fails to do so most of the time? Moreover, have you noticed that, in many cases, they not only fail to cover the spread but also lose the game? This could be indicative of game fixing, known as point shaping, where the outcome is manipulated to defy the expectations of the majority of bettors.

394  Economy / Trading Discussion / Re: Do we need to have a stop loss if we are 100% positive about a trade? on: December 02, 2023, 12:56:12 PM
I believe it depends on the type of trade you are making. When you are in the spot market, you don't really need to worry a lot about stop-loss apart from a few cases where you might have bought a cryptocurrency that is highly volatile and you fear it may lose a lot of value in no time causing you a big loss and such tokens barely manage to regain value quickly after that and your investment will get stuck for a good long while which isn't good for a trader.

However, someone who trades in the futures market, it becomes essential to use stop-loss because you surely can't afford to lose all your amount in liquidation in case the market doesn't move in the direction you predicted, and no matter how confident you are, the market can always surprise you.
Whether you're in spot trading or futures trading, as long as you're not confident with how your trades will end up, then I suggest to use stop-loss especially if you are doing leverage when trading. That is from my own point of view, but if you do trading with an amount that you can afford to lose, then using stop-loss might not be necesary at all.

However, if you have uncontrollable fears from losing regardless of its amount, I guess trading with stop-loss is highly advisable. But make sure to overcome your future fears because that won't make you a successful and profitable trader in the long run.
